2015 Sierra Denal 6.2 8sp Black on Black

sunroof, driver alert, brake controller, rear bluray/entertainment, driver assist handle

$59095 MSRP

$53320 Price before rebates (originally was 53250, but for coming through with the order I didn't say anything)

$50070 with 2500 gm, 750 usaa

$55268 Out the door, (tax 4798, 150 dealer rip off fee, 250 license)

 

First impression, I love the truck. Looks great and so far drives great, just under a 100 miles. After reading here I was obviously concerned about getting the 8sp (still am) but good news is I haven't experienced any clunking. Been some minor trying to find gears, but no clunking jerking or drivetrain noise. Tried up and down hill slow and fast launches, going slow then flooring it. Pretty much everything I could think of and nothing, just the power of the 6.2. I had a 04 CTS V so I'm pretty familiar with clunking/noise and couldn't get the truck to make any noise . Took peoples advice and drove on the hwy over 70, shifting from 2 auto 4wd and back, no problems or vibrations. Not sure if my truck has the new headlight tsb done, but I can say the headlights (which should be hid) light up the road pretty good. Def no shadows on the road and some light on both sides, don't see how on a dark country road you couldn't see anything. Still I will be getting a set of hids, no reason a 50k truck shouldn't have hid. As others have said ridiculous, but I knew that going in

 

Honestly said to myself while driving I don't see anything (knock on wood) that people have said online ie 6.2 lag, clunking/shifting, headlights can't see, screen to bright and slow, seats hurt their legs (I"m over 300lb round and over 6ft tall)

 

Anyways hopefully I don't start getting transmission issues around the 600+ mark but other than that I really can say the truck seems pretty great for my first brand new purchase. I feel like for just above 50k I got a hell of a deal. 6.2 has power, rides smooth on the hwy, 2 kids in the back quite watching blurays not kicking the back of my seat, I have my cooled seats on with the ac blowing while my wife has her side on hot haha
